    Slow startup Windows 10, then cannot access Explorer or Setups


    Strange. I noticed the problem with the cursor freezing had returned Win 10 ver 1903 with latest updates, so deleted the mouse driver and restarted. That fixed the cursor problem. Later I was using a newly updated Topaz program that does AI sharpening of photos, and everything froze.


    On restart, Win 10 took several minutes to open. When I couldn't open Explorer to see if the photo had saved, or Adobe Bridge to do the same, I decided to reset the system to an earlier date. That took a while because I couldn't immediately open Settings. But I found a way and reset to an earlier point. However, the slow start up and no access to Explorer continues. Stranger still is that Firefox opens more slowly than usual and I can use Gmail.


    I haven't yet tried to open Uninstall Programs to eliminate the Topaz program I was using at the time of the original freeze, as the reset to an earlier date should have fixed that. The only problem I may have caused was to delete the earlier not-updated Topaz program by deleting it from the C: drive instead of uninstall programs. However, things worked normally after that deletion.


    So I'm using a Dell 8700 with an i7 processor and 24gb of RAM, running Win 10 pro version 1903, which to date has performed very well.

    Windows 10: In the new version of Windows, Explorer has a section called Quick Access. This includes your frequent folders and recent files. Explorer defaults to opening this page when you open a new window. If you’d rather open the usual This PC, with links to your drives and library folders, follow these steps:

    • Open a new Explorer window.
    • Click View in the ribbon.
    • Click Options.
    • Under General, next to “Open File Explorer to:” choose “This PC.”
    • Click OK

    For your slow performance issue please fo the following :

    Step 1: Make sure you have all the latest Windows updates installed.

    Select Start.

    Go to Settings.

    Select the Update and Security icon.

    Choose Windows Update tab in the sidebar

    Select Check for updates. Check for available updates, it will begin downloading automatically.

    Step 2:

    There could be many reasons why your computer running slow during start-up, sometimes a slow computer is caused by programs running in the background. Check and remove or disable any TSRs and startup programs that automatically start each time the computer
    boots.

    Right-click on your taskbar (at the bottom of the screen) and open Task Manager. Click on the Startup tab, and review for any applications that may be set to run at startup.

    Step 3: Delete temp files that can help improve computer performance.

    Open the Start menu and type %temp% in the Search field.

    Press Enter and a Temp folder should open.

    You can delete all files found in this folder and, if any files are in use and cannot be deleted, they can be skipped.

    Step 5: Run SFC Scannow

    Press Windows Key+X to open the Power User Tasks Menu.

    Select Command Prompt (Admin).

    After the User Account Control prompt appears. Click Yes.

    At the Command Prompt, type sfc /scannow and press Enter.

    Step 6: To Run Defrag

    In the Windows Search box, on the taskbar, type defrag and select the Defragment and Optimize Drives option in the search results.

    Click on the drive you want to defrag and optimize.

    Click the Optimize button to being the defragmentation and optimization process.
